Understanding Disabilities Beyond the Physical
Disability is not limited to restricted body function or movement. It can affect speech, senses, learning, communication and social interaction. While many associate disabilities mainly with mobility limitations, the reality is much broader and often deeply personal. People living with disabilities may struggle with daily tasks, but they also experience invisible challenges such as anxiety, social withdrawal and emotional fatigue.
A world with true disability awareness in 2025 acknowledges these unseen barriers and takes steps to reduce them. Communities, workplaces and schools need to build environments where individuals feel confident, independent and valued rather than limited by their condition.

Occupational Therapy and Daily Functional Recovery
Many people living with disabilities need assistance with tasks such as holding objects, writing, dressing, bathing or navigating the home safely. Occupational therapists address these challenges using a structured plan that encourages independence at the patient’s own pace.
Occupational therapists evaluate the patient’s lifestyle, mobility challenges, emotional needs and environmental limitations. Once the assessment is complete, personalised interventions are introduced to enhance independence and comfort.
These often include:
- Motor skill training for hand and arm coordination
- Sensory integration exercises
- Behavioural therapy for cognitive and developmental conditions
- Adaptive equipment training for feeding, dressing and mobility
- Home modification suggestions to ensure safety and accessibility
